    How the IPSE Finance Bridge Works

    So, how does this bridge actually work? Let's break it down, guys. The IPSE Finance Bridge facilitates cross-chain transactions through a process that involves locking assets on one chain and releasing them on another. When a user initiates a transaction to transfer assets, those assets are first locked within a smart contract on the source chain. This means the assets are temporarily held in a secure vault, which is a common practice in cross-chain bridges. Then, an equivalent amount of the assets is released on the destination chain. The bridge uses a combination of smart contracts, oracles, and other technologies to ensure that this process is secure, efficient, and reliable.     The Underlying Technology and Mechanisms

    At its core, the IPSE Finance Bridge relies on a network of smart contracts that manage the locking and unlocking of assets. These smart contracts are basically self-executing programs that automatically handle the transfer process. When a user initiates a transfer, the smart contract on the source chain locks the assets, and the bridge then triggers the release of an equivalent amount of assets on the destination chain. Often, these smart contracts are combined with oracles, which provide the bridge with off-chain data and information. Oracles are like data feeds that relay information between different blockchains, ensuring the bridge has the latest information about transactions and asset balances. The use of robust security measures, such as auditing and testing, is also critical to protect users' funds. The bridge also uses a system of validators to ensure that transactions are valid and secure. These validators are like watchdogs, constantly monitoring the bridge to protect against malicious activity. IPSE Finance Bridge's underlying technology and mechanisms are designed to provide a secure and reliable way to transfer assets across different blockchain networks, allowing users to access a wider range of DeFi opportunities.

    Step-by-Step Guide to Using the Bridge

    Using the IPSE Finance Bridge is usually a pretty straightforward process, but let's break it down step-by-step to make sure you're all set. First, you'll need a wallet that supports both the source and destination chains, like MetaMask or Trust Wallet. Make sure you have the necessary tokens in your wallet. Next, you'll navigate to the bridge's website. There, you'll select the source and destination chains, as well as the asset you want to transfer. After entering the amount you want to transfer, you'll be prompted to review the transaction details, including any associated fees. Once you're happy with the details, you'll confirm the transaction in your wallet. The bridge will then lock the assets on the source chain and release an equivalent amount on the destination chain. This entire process typically takes a few minutes, depending on the network congestion. When using the IPSE Finance Bridge, it’s also important to be aware of the fees associated with bridging. These fees can vary depending on the network and the specific bridge in use. By following these steps, you can safely and efficiently transfer your assets across different blockchain networks using the IPSE Finance Bridge. Always make sure to double-check the details before confirming the transaction and only use reputable bridges to minimize the risk.

    Smart Contract Vulnerabilities and Security Risks

    Smart contracts are at the heart of the IPSE Finance Bridge, but they can be vulnerable to security threats. If there are bugs in the smart contract code, hackers could exploit them to steal funds. To mitigate this risk, it's essential to choose bridges that have been thoroughly audited by reputable security firms. These audits provide an independent review of the smart contract code, identifying potential vulnerabilities. It's also critical to stay informed about the bridge's security measures and any reported incidents. By staying informed, you can make informed decisions about your bridge transactions and protect your assets. Security is a continuous process, so bridges are regularly updated to address new threats and improve security protocols. You must always stay informed and exercise caution when using the IPSE Finance Bridge and other DeFi tools.

    Liquidity Risks and Slippage

    Liquidity is the lifeblood of DeFi, and it's essential for smooth transactions on cross-chain bridges. If there isn't enough liquidity on the destination chain, your transactions could be subject to slippage. Slippage happens when the price of an asset changes during the transaction, resulting in a less favorable exchange rate. This can be especially problematic during times of high volatility or low liquidity. To minimize slippage, you should always check the liquidity on the destination chain before initiating a bridge transaction. You can use decentralized exchanges (DEXs) to assess the depth of the liquidity pools for the assets you want to transfer. Be aware that during periods of high network congestion, transaction times could also increase. By understanding the risks associated with liquidity, you can mitigate the negative impacts and ensure your transactions are as efficient as possible. By paying attention to liquidity and market conditions, you can minimize potential risks and ensure a smoother bridging experience.

    Regulatory and Compliance Concerns

    The DeFi space, including cross-chain bridges, is still evolving. Regulatory frameworks are emerging and vary across different jurisdictions. Because cross-chain bridges can involve moving assets across borders, they could be subject to existing regulations regarding money transmission, securities, and anti-money laundering (AML). Depending on your location and the specific bridge you use, you may be required to comply with certain reporting requirements or adhere to Know Your Customer (KYC) procedures. The regulatory landscape of DeFi is continually evolving. Therefore, it's essential to stay updated on the latest developments and consult with legal and financial professionals to ensure you are compliant with all applicable regulations. By being proactive and informed, you can minimize the risk of regulatory issues and safeguard your participation in the DeFi world.
